Silver gelatin print by James Jarché, mounted on board. Portrait of British sculptor Sir Jacob Epstein (1880-1959) in his studio, peering up at his 1934-35 sculpture 'Behold the Man (Ecce Homo)'. The sculpture now sits in the ruins of the old cathedral, Coventry.
